I recently put some SLP LM's on my brother's 08 GT and they sound great under acceleration. They are basically a stainless muffler delete with very nice double wall polished tips. Not too loud at idle and also sound evil as the car decelerates in gear and they have that old muscle car sound you mentioned. Intsallation and fit/finish very good.

I've had the Flowmasters, and just last night changed over to Macs. The flows are nice. Fairly quiet until you romp on it, then they roar. The Macs are much louder and more aggressive. I had the Macs and they sounded great, but they drone worse than any other axlebacks handsdown. Way too much for me. I've got the Hooker Aerochambers now. I really like them, but they're expensive. I heard the SLP Loudmouths and loved them. You might want to look into the Pypes midmufflers too.

I had LMs and to me they sounded like crap, too obnoxious and my car sounded like a dump truck. The LMs had to go after a week. I switched to the GTAs and they were too quiet. I then switched to the Stingers and I would recommend them if you're looking for beefy and deep sound but not obnoxious. Hope drone doesn't bother you tho. I'm planning to go with the Stingers again on my new GT.

I have the Flowmasters. They sound a little louder at idle. They have a good sound when your on the throttle. They are not the loudest, but that's not what i was looking for, just a nice sound. The 4 inch tips look good as well. There is little to no extra noise inside when driving at normal speeds.
I guess its a question of what you want. I think it would be hard to gauge the sound off of your computer. I would say find friends with different mufflers or go to a car show and see if you can get people to start their cars up and see what you like.
